Elise Bouffard is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Molecular Biology and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Elise Bouffard has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 343 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 4 papers in Molecular Biology and 4 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Elise Bouffard's work include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(7 papers),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(3 papers) and Silicon Nanostructures and Photoluminescence (3 papers). Elise Bouffard is often cited by papers focused on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(7 papers),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(3 papers) and Silicon Nanostructures and Photoluminescence (3 papers). Elise Bouffard collaborates with scholars based in France and United States. Elise Bouffard's co-authors include Alain Morère, Khaled El Cheikh, Marcel Garcia, Magali Gary‐Bobo, Marie Maynadier, Jean‐Olivier Durand, Arnaud Chaix, Frédérique Cunin, Philippe Maillard and Olivier Mongin and has published in prestigious journals such as Advanced Materials,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and International Journal of Molecular Sciences.
